Solution for 5x+19=14x-89 equation:


Simplifying
5x + 19 = 14x + -89

Reorder the terms:
19 + 5x = 14x + -89

Reorder the terms:
19 + 5x = -89 + 14x

Solving
19 + 5x = -89 + 14x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-14x' to each side of the equation.
19 + 5x + -14x = -89 + 14x + -14x

Combine like terms: 5x + -14x = -9x
19 + -9x = -89 + 14x + -14x

Combine like terms: 14x + -14x = 0
19 + -9x = -89 + 0
19 + -9x = -89

Add '-19' to each side of the equation.
19 + -19 + -9x = -89 + -19

Combine like terms: 19 + -19 = 0
0 + -9x = -89 + -19
-9x = -89 + -19

Combine like terms: -89 + -19 = -108
-9x = -108

Divide each side by '-9'.
x = 12

Simplifying
x = 12
